Long-Term Style Evolution and Seasonal Adaptation
Samantha Middy outfit planning evolves with industry trends, yet she anchors each season with timeless silhouettes and reliable textiles. Seasonal adjustments focus on weight, texture, and sleeve length rather than dramatic redesigns, making wardrobe updates efficient and future-proof.
- Audit your closet quarterly and identify pieces that no longer align with your current role or climate.
- Invest in one high-quality outercoat and one elevated casual jacket that can serve multiple seasons.
- Standardize measurement notes for preferred tailoring, such as sleeve length and trouser break.
- Create a capsule color palette of five neutrals and two accent tones to guide purchases and mixing.

How does Samantha Middy build a capsule wardrobe without sacrificing versatility?
She selects neutral base pieces in high-quality fabrics, adds two or three statement outer layers, and limits prints to one focal item per outfit to maximize mixing potential.
What tailoring tricks does she use to make off-the-rack pieces feel custom?
She focuses on sleeve shortening, subtle waist nipping, and hemming trousers to ankle length, which instantly refines proportions without altering the overall design.
Can her approach work in a strictly formal industry like finance or law?
Yes, by prioritizing sharp suiting, conservative color palettes, and minimal accessories, she adapts her methodology to meet formal dress codes while preserving comfort and mobility.
What maintenance habits keep her outfits looking polished day after day?
She steam instead of iron delicate fabrics, store coats on wide hangers to retain structure, and rotate shoes with cedar inserts, which preserves shape and extends the life of each piece.
